About Egis
Egis is a global leader in engineering and infrastructure services, with operations spanning transportation, urban development, energy, and environmental sectors. Egis Road and Tunnel Operations (ERTO) is responsible for the management of two of Ireland’s most critical transport corridors — the Dublin Tunnel and the Jack Lynch Tunnel in Cork.
Managing this infrastructure requires a deep commitment to safety, operational continuity, and technological agility. ERTO’s responsibilities include:
- Toll collection
- Traffic control and tunnel safety
- Emergency and contingency planning
- Regular infrastructure and equipment inspections
Ensuring safe and efficient tunnel operations means having a reliable, modern system for asset management — which became the core objective of this transformation project
Problem
Managing On-Prem Environments
ERTO was relying on an existing on-premises IBM Maximo environment that was no longer aligned with the organization's evolving needs for mobility, cloud-readiness, and operational speed.
Challenges included:
- Limited accessibility and flexibility for remote and mobile teams
- Gaps in real-time visibility across tunnel assets and infrastructure
- Manual processes that slowed down inspections and work completion
- Increasing pressure to reduce disruption for tunnel users during maintenance windows
The organization needed to modernize its asset management platform to support faster, smarter, and more connected field operations.
Solution
A Comprehensive Digital Transformation
Naviam was engaged by ERTO on a three-year contract to deliver a comprehensive digital transformation of its asset management environment. The project focused on two key deliverables:
- Migrating IBM Maximo to the cloud, enabling enhanced system accessibility, scalability, and reliability
- Integrating Fingertip, Naviam's mobile solution, to give the ERTO field workforce direct, in-field access to Maximo functionality
By combining Maximo Application Suite with Fingertip by Naviam, ERTO gained:
- Real-time, point-of-work visibility and data capture
- Fully mobile work management, even offline
- Faster workflows and more agile maintenance scheduling
This modern architecture gave the tunnel operator the tools to digitize, streamline, and scale its critical infrastructure operations
